Key active compounds

  • Gamma-linolenic acid (GLA): An omega-6 polyunsaturated fatty acid (a type of healthy fat the body cannot make in large amounts on its own) concentrated in borage seed oil. Acts as a building block for anti-inflammatory signaling molecules called eicosanoids. Clinical trials using GLA from borage oil have shown modest improvements in rheumatoid arthritis symptoms and blood lipid profiles.
  • Pyrrolizidine alkaloids (PAs) — lycopsamine, intermedine, amabiline, supinine, thesinine: A class of naturally occurring plant compounds found mainly in borage leaves, stems, and roots, with lower levels in flowers and seeds. Unsaturated PAs are potentially hepatotoxic (liver-damaging) and possibly carcinogenic at high or chronic exposures. Their presence is the primary safety concern with borage leaf use.
  • Flavonoids and phenolic acids: Polyphenolic compounds (plant-based antioxidants) naturally present in the leaves. Associated with antioxidant and mild anti-inflammatory activity in lab studies; human evidence is preliminary.
  • Mucilage and soluble fibers: Viscous polysaccharides (gel-like carbohydrates) in the soft leaf tissue. May have mild soothing effects on mucous membranes and contribute to gut comfort, though no clinical trials have confirmed this in borage specifically.

Prep and pairing ideas

With what it grows alongside: Borage self-seeds prolifically and is a natural companion to strawberries in the garden — and on the plate. A few borage flowers scattered over a strawberry salad with balsamic and mint is a classic combination that plays the cucumber-sweetness contrast beautifully.

In summer drinks: Float three or four borage flowers in a glass of sparkling water with cucumber slices and a sprig of mint. The flowers hold their color for about 20–30 minutes before wilting, so add them just before serving. For a more dramatic presentation, freeze single flowers into ice cubes.

In grain and pasta dishes: Young borage leaves, roughly chopped, can replace spinach in ricotta-stuffed pasta or be stirred into a farro salad with roasted tomatoes and olives. The heat mellows the mild prickliness of the leaf surface.

Bottom line

Borage is a genuinely useful and beautiful culinary herb when used in its natural role: as an occasional edible flower and fresh-leaf garnish that brings cucumber flavor and visual drama to food and drink. At culinary amounts, it contributes meaningful nutrients and fits comfortably in a whole-food, plant-based diet.

The deeper functional story belongs to borage seed oil, which has modest but real human trial evidence for rheumatoid arthritis symptom relief and modest lipid benefits — provided the oil is PA-free and used under medical supervision.

The limits matter here too: pyrrolizidine alkaloids make daily leaf use inadvisable, borage tea is best avoided, clinical evidence for eczema is negative, and several populations (pregnant people, those with liver disease, people on blood thinners) should steer clear or consult a doctor first. Use borage for what it does well — bring a plate to life — and seek professional guidance before reaching for the seed oil.

PA safety rule #1: Never use borage leaves medicinally or in large daily quantities. Pyrrolizidine alkaloids accumulate with repeated exposure and can cause hepatic veno-occlusive disease (a serious condition where small blood vessels in the liver become blocked).

PA safety rule #2: If using borage seed oil as a supplement, choose products that are certified PA-free or PA-reduced. Not all commercial oils have been tested.

Pregnancy: Avoid all internal use of borage herb and non-verified borage oils. PAs are potentially teratogenic (capable of harming fetal development), and safety data during pregnancy are absent.

Breastfeeding: Also avoid internal borage herb; PAs may transfer to breast milk.

Children and adolescents: More vulnerable to hepatotoxicity (liver damage); internal medicinal use of borage herb is not appropriate and seed oil should only be used under specialist supervision.

Liver disease or elevated liver enzymes: The additive hepatotoxic risk from PAs makes borage herb unsafe for this group.

Blood thinners (warfarin, DOACs, aspirin, clopidogrel): Borage oil's effects on prostaglandins and platelet function may increase bleeding risk or interfere with INR (a clotting test used to monitor warfarin).

Epilepsy or seizure history: High-dose GLA has been linked to seizures in case reports; caution or avoidance is advised.

Other PA-containing herbs (comfrey, coltsfoot): Using these alongside borage increases cumulative PA exposure. Avoid combining them.

Hepatotoxic medications (methotrexate, isoniazid, certain chemotherapy agents): Combined liver stress from PAs and these drugs is a real risk.

What the evidence supports
  • Clearly separates culinary borage (leaves/flowers) from borage seed oil, and explains why most research focuses on the oil’s GLA content.
  • Accurately highlights pyrrolizidine alkaloids (PAs) as the key safety issue and frames borage as an occasional garnish rather than a daily green.
  • Fair summary of human data: modest symptom relief for rheumatoid arthritis with PA-free, GLA-standardized seed oil; little to no benefit for eczema.
  • Notes realistic nutrition contributions (vitamin C, iron, potassium) at typical culinary portions within a plant-forward diet.
Where evidence is developing
  • Cardiometabolic findings (lipids, HDL/triglycerides) come from small, short trials; there are no studies showing reductions in events like heart attacks or strokes.
  • Digestive claims are largely traditional or preclinical; controlled human studies are lacking.
  • Skin outcomes remain mixed: topical or oral borage oil has not consistently improved atopic dermatitis in trials.
  • Real-world PA exposure from leaves varies by plant part, preparation, and sourcing; standardized testing of commercial products is inconsistent.
Things to keep in mind
  • Culinary use: keep portions small (about a small handful of young leaves or a few flowers) and occasional; avoid medicinal-strength teas made from leaves due to PA load.
  • Supplements: clinical trials used roughly 1–3 g/day of GLA (often 1–6 g borage oil, depending on concentration) for 6–24 weeks—only with PA-free/PA-reduced products and clinician oversight.
  • Who should avoid or seek medical advice first: pregnant or breastfeeding individuals, children/adolescents, anyone with liver disease or elevated liver enzymes, people on blood thinners, those with seizure history, and those taking hepatotoxic medications.
  • Expectations: culinary borage will not deliver the GLA doses studied in supplements; even with seed oil, benefits are modest and should not replace prescribed care for rheumatoid arthritis or eczema.
